Output 99c2329cb10ef5a9eb1c7e0161ed486a0cb5d1dce1eb8b83dc4e666deb0594cf:1

value
1090300
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fe5b8c252af03503dacbf36a6534960d087143fa OP_EQUAL
address
3QswE6Yne5KxZ23cjaGRMcvntpm33eRYpT
transaction
99c2329cb10ef5a9eb1c7e0161ed486a0cb5d1dce1eb8b83dc4e666deb0594cf
confirmations
304607
spent
true